Yeah...less than a week is kind of jumping the gun.

Just so you know, the list doesn't just get sent to HR where it is promply plugged into the system and emails are sent. The process of inputting the information, formatting and sending the emails is outsourced to another company. The process may seem simple, but the sheer numbers make it very difficult. They simply don't have the man power and when you get further along in the process and your paperwork is repeatedly lost in the shuffle, you'll understand why they hired someone else to do it for them.

Also, this is all assuming that they have even sheduled the PEPC(s). They most likely will not send the emails until then.
